OEM Briggs & Stratton 19197 Flywheel Holder – Secure Engine Flywheels with Confidence


The OEM Briggs & Stratton 19197 Flywheel Holder is an essential service tool designed to hold the flywheel securely in place during engine maintenance or repair. Whether you're removing the flywheel nut, adjusting valve timing, or working on ignition components, this tool prevents the flywheel from rotating—helping you work safely and efficiently.


Engineered specifically for small engines, this flywheel holder features a non-marring design to protect delicate fins and components. It provides a stable grip without damaging the flywheel, making it ideal for professional mechanics, small engine repair shops, and DIY engine builders alike.

Q1: What is the Briggs & Stratton 19197 flywheel holder used for?
A: It’s used to hold the flywheel securely in place while performing maintenance such as flywheel nut removal, timing adjustments, valve work, or ignition repairs on small engines.


Q2: Is this tool compatible with all Briggs & Stratton engines?
A: It fits most Briggs & Stratton horizontal and vertical shaft engines. Always check compatibility with your engine model for best results.


Q3: Will this tool damage my flywheel?
A: No. It is designed with a non-marring surface to grip the flywheel without damaging the aluminum fins or surrounding components.
